Local Laws Overview:

In Huddersfield, United Kingdom, health insurance is regulated by the Financial Conduct Authority (FCA) and the Prudential Regulation Authority (PRA). These regulatory bodies ensure that insurance providers comply with laws and regulations to protect consumers. It is important to familiarize yourself with the terms and conditions of your health insurance policy to understand your rights and obligations.

Frequently Asked Questions:

1. What is the difference between private health insurance and the National Health Service (NHS) in Huddersfield?

Private health insurance allows individuals to access private healthcare services, while the NHS provides free healthcare services to residents. Private health insurance offers quicker access to treatment and a wider range of services.

2. Can my health insurance claim be denied in Huddersfield?

Yes, health insurance claims can be denied for various reasons, such as policy exclusions, lack of documentation, or pre-existing conditions. It is important to review your policy carefully and seek legal advice if your claim is denied unfairly.

7. What are the common exclusions in health insurance policies in Huddersfield?

Common exclusions in health insurance policies may include pre-existing conditions, cosmetic procedures, experimental treatments, and certain high-risk activities. It is important to understand these exclusions to avoid any surprises when making a claim.

8. What is the role of the Financial Ombudsman Service (FOS) in resolving health insurance disputes in Huddersfield?

The Financial Ombudsman Service (FOS) is an independent body that helps resolve disputes between consumers and financial service providers, including health insurance companies. If you are unable to resolve a dispute with your insurer, you can escalate it to the FOS for impartial mediation.
